World War II Memorial

The World War II Memorial, located in Washington, D.C., honors the 16 million Americans who served in the military during the war, as well as the millions of civilians who contributed to the war effort. Opened in 2004, it features a circular plaza with a large pool, surrounded by 56 granite pillars representing the U.S. states and territories. The memorial symbolizes unity, sacrifice, and the resilience of the nation. It serves as a space for reflection and remembrance of the significant impact of World War II on American society and the world.
